Posso applicare la classe ScaleSquare quando apro sfw esterni?
Sul mio sito www.paesaggioitaliano.eu, il click di un puntino rosso richiama un swf esterno.
Vorrei applicare la classe ScaleSquare all'apertura dell'swf
E' possibile?
Come?
Posso applicare la classe ScaleSquare quando apro sfw esterni?
Sul mio sito www.paesaggioitaliano.eu, il click di un puntino rosso richiama un swf esterno.
Vorrei applicare la classe ScaleSquare all'apertura dell'swf
E' possibile?
Come?
penso di si ....dovrebbe essere la stessa cosa nell'applciarla a img esterneOriginariamente inviato da Lux
Posso applicare la classe ScaleSquare quando apro sfw esterni?
Sul mio sito www.paesaggioitaliano.eu, il click di un puntino rosso richiama un swf esterno.
Vorrei applicare la classe ScaleSquare all'apertura dell'swf
E' possibile?
Come?
ovviamente x poterla applicare devi essere sicuro di aver caricato il file swf quindi
ti fai una funzione di preload e quando il clip è stato caricato gli metti la chiamata della classe
con una cosa del genere sul frame la funz di preload x il clip
anche se adesso cè la classe moviecliploader x caricare file esterni vedi articolo di and80
sul plsCodice PHP:
_root.box._alpha=0;
function preload1(clip1){
car = clip1.getBytesLoaded();
tot = clip1.getBytesTotal();
perc = Math.floor((car/tot)*100);
clip1.createTextField("testo", 1, 0, 0, 200, 20);
clip1.testo.wordWrap = true;
format = new TextFormat();
format.color = 0xffffff;
format.font = "Verdana";
format.size = "10";
clip1._alpha=0;
_root.box._alpha=0;
if(!isNaN(perc)) {
clip1.testo.text = "Caricamento.."+perc+"%";
clip1.testo.setTextFormat(format);
}
if (car >= tot && car > perc && perc == 100) {
clearInterval(a);
clip1.testo.text = "";
var mio = new ScaleSquare(clip1, 4, 4, clip1._width, clip1._height, false, effetto);
clip1._alpha=100;
}
}
on(release){
_root.box._x = 100;
_root.box._y = 100;
_root.box.loadMovie("finestra.swf");
a = setInterval(preload1, 50, _root.box);
effetto=mx.transitions.easing.Elastic.easeInOut;
}
![]()
la verità non è una meretrice che si getta al collo di chi non la vuole ma anzi essa è dotata di una così altera bellezza che anche chi sacrifica tutto per ottenerla non è sicuro di averla raggiunta !
Grazie crescenzo
la classe scalesquare funziona
Non funzionano gli effetti Bounce, Elastic, Strong, ecc.
e va molto a rilento
Puoi aiutarmi a vedere meglio dovè l'errore?
http://www.paesaggioitaliano.eu/Scal...lesquare2.html
qui il sogente: http://www.paesaggioitaliano.eu/Scal...alesquare2.fla
ma quella che vedo ti funge...
e poi magari aumenta il framerate del filmato
ps x cambiare effetto basta agire su questa riga del pls
_root.box.loadMovie("finestra.swf");
a = setInterval(preload1, 50, _root.box);
effetto=mx.transitions.easing.Elastic.easeInOut;
e metti l'effetto che vuoi
la verità non è una meretrice che si getta al collo di chi non la vuole ma anzi essa è dotata di una così altera bellezza che anche chi sacrifica tutto per ottenerla non è sicuro di averla raggiunta !
Tutto funziona correttemente, eccetto alcune stranezze.
Prova ad aprire la finestra premendo il pulsante
http://www.paesaggioitaliano.eu/Scal...lesquare2.html
L'ombra della finestra, in basso viene tagliata, ma se passi col muse sulla scritta "Galleria Fotografica", l'ombra si rimette a posto.
Poi se clicco di nuovo il pulsante "enter" si chiude la finestra.
Ma se riclicco da capo il pulsante "enter", l'effetto scalesquare avviene in modo strano.
Le noti queste stranezze?
strano a me nn lo fa quando ricaricoOriginariamente inviato da Lux
Tutto funziona correttemente, eccetto alcune stranezze.
Prova ad aprire la finestra premendo il pulsante
http://www.paesaggioitaliano.eu/Scal...lesquare2.html
L'ombra della finestra, in basso viene tagliata, ma se passi col muse sulla scritta "Galleria Fotografica", l'ombra si rimette a posto.
Poi se clicco di nuovo il pulsante "enter" si chiude la finestra.
Ma se riclicco da capo il pulsante "enter", l'effetto scalesquare avviene in modo strano.
Le noti queste stranezze?
cmq prova a mettere questo nel pls
on(release){
if(!aperto){
_root.box._x = 100;
_root.box._y = 100;
_root.box.loadMovie("finestra.swf");
a = setInterval(preload1, 50, _root.box);
//effetto=mx.transitions.easing.Elastic.easeInOut;
effetto=mx.transitions.easing.Bounce.easeOut;
aperto=true;
}else{
unloadMovie(_root.box);
removeMovieClip(_root.maschbox);
aperto=false;
}
}
provando a rimuovere la maschera
![]()
la verità non è una meretrice che si getta al collo di chi non la vuole ma anzi essa è dotata di una così altera bellezza che anche chi sacrifica tutto per ottenerla non è sicuro di averla raggiunta !
ho cambiato il codice al pulsante ma gli strani effetti ci sono sempre.
http://www.paesaggioitaliano.eu/Scal...lesquare2.html
http://www.paesaggioitaliano.eu/Scal...alesquare2.fla
nn lo apro uso flash mx 2004Originariamente inviato da Lux
ho cambiato il codice al pulsante ma gli strani effetti ci sono sempre.
http://www.paesaggioitaliano.eu/Scal...lesquare2.html
http://www.paesaggioitaliano.eu/Scal...alesquare2.fla
![]()
la verità non è una meretrice che si getta al collo di chi non la vuole ma anzi essa è dotata di una così altera bellezza che anche chi sacrifica tutto per ottenerla non è sicuro di averla raggiunta !